Abstract

We prove that the Schäfer–Wayne short pulse equation (SPE) which describes the propagation of ultra-short optical pulses in nonlinear media is integrable. First, we discover a Lax pair of the SPE which turns out to be of the Wadati–Konno–Ichikawa type. Second, we construct a chain of transformations which relates the SPE with the sine-Gordon equation. 1
